Abstract :
In this paper, a new model of target localization based on underwater sensor networks (USN) is proposed. And several target localization algorithms used in this model are researched. The mathematical principles and the performance of these algorithms are studied in detail. And this paper has also done some research in how the target position and the number of sensors affect the localization precision which can guide the intelligent management of the sensors.
